Description
Want to learn how to help a community thrive? Are you interested in building and maintaining physical structures, so that people who live in them have warmth, safety and lovely places to live? And do you want to learn about open source systems that provide community members with practical digital tools so that they can co-create their lives? Here’s a great opportunity to learn how to use tools, both physically and digitally. At Avnø we have 6000 square meters that needs care and attention, so that people living here has an awesome place to live their life, learn and grow. The tasks are a mix of regular chores, repairs and new projects. We make sure there’s always heat, water and that everything just works. And we build new stuff when we see there’s something missing or we feel inspired to add structures or functionality to our spaces. Furthermore we have a complex system of IT-infrastructure that allow us to do lots of amazing stuff digitally.
Accommodation, food and transport arrangements
Be part of a multicultural eco-village in the making and learn skills related to social interactions, personal development, health and wellness, empowerment in an English language environment. As a volunteer you receive free room and 3 daily meals. Your room is equipped with your own bath/toilet and kitchenette in the hallway. You will live in an aspiring eco-village together with residents, teachers and students of the courses. Car service is available to the local train station.
Training during the activity
You will be able to join most sessions in some of our ongoing courses offered by Avno Hojskole (People’s College) in your free time. As a volunteer you will have a buddy, who helps you transition into the community and one or more working group mentors who supports you in regards to the work and your general well-being.
